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ric Macclenny Hagerstown
Housing Index 92.0 110.5
Median Home Price $266,250 $193,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$1400 $1500
Average Rent (2 BR House) $1424.0 $1600

Housing Comparison: Macclenny vs Hagerstown

  • In Macclenny, the median home price is higher at $266,250, while in Hagerstown it is $193,000.
  • In Hagerstown, the rental for a two-bedroom apartment stands at $1,500, while it is $1,400 in Macclenny.

Utilities

The cost of utilities such as electricity, natural gas, and other services can significantly impact the overall cost of living.

Metric Macclenny Hagerstown
Electricity Price $13.89 $17.41
Natural Gas Price $26.13 $18.44
Other Utilities $250 $200

Utilities Comparison: Macclenny vs Hagerstown

  • Hagerstown has higher electricity costs at $17.41 per kWh, versus $13.89 in Macclenny.
  • Natural gas is more expensive in Macclenny at $26.13 per unit, while it is cheaper at $18.44 in Hagerstown.
  • Other utility costs are higher in Macclenny at an average of $250, compared to Hagerstown with $200.
